Description

The Federal Research Center for Vegetable Growing (FRCVG), operating in close cooperation with the Lomonosov Moscow State University, stands as a premier scientific institution in the Russian Federation. With a rich history rooted in decades of rigorous agricultural research, the center serves as a cornerstone for the development of modern plant breeding and biotechnological practices. It is internationally recognized for its comprehensive approach to crop science, integrating fundamental academic research with practical applications that address the critical challenges of contemporary horticulture and industrial agriculture.

The organization’s expertise spans a vast spectrum, ranging from the genetic improvement of fruit and ornamental crops to the study of plant physiology and adaptive resilience. By maintaining a balance between traditional breeding methods and cutting-edge laboratory techniques, the institution plays a vital role in food security and landscape design. Its reputation is built upon decades of scholarly contributions, a robust network of experimental stations, and a commitment to maintaining high standards of genetic purity and ecological sustainability across its diverse research focus areas.
